We came here to celebrate a friend’s birthday that enjoys karaoke. We took the bus over as it was only a 10 minute bus ride and ubered back home since we would be drinking.
This was our second karaoke night here as we had such fun the first time. There is an interesting bunch of regulars that come here to karaoke. We saw a few of the same regulars from the last time.
There is a ground level bar and tables and you walk downstairs to the karaoke section. They have a large binder with songs arranged by artist or song title. You write your song and name on a little piece of paper and hand it to the DJ.
Several women in our group sang Take It Easy (Eagles) and It’s Too Late (Carole King) and as a group while another guy sang the Brady Bunch theme. 2 other girls in our group did a Taylor Swift song I think.
They have several good beers in tap, wine and other drinks. I had 2 pints of Parallel 49’s Tricycle. It is a Grapefruit Radler so a good summer beer that is under 5%. I ordered the house red wine but received the house white wine but she was ok with that as she also likes white wine and did not want me to return it. So it worked out. Others had one of the draft beers or wine as well.
It’s a lot of fun and worth going to! There’s really good and not so good singers but the audience is very supportive of anyone that gets up to sing. You don’t have time get up and sing but you can sing along as you’ll likely recognize many of the songs. They also have live music and sports games on too. So stop by if you’re looking for a good time in a Saturday night!
